Breaking Free from Societal Constraints

The novel's protagonist, Anya, is an extraordinary young woman who defies the conventional labels and expectations that often confine girls. With her unconventional style and unwavering determination, she shatters the stereotypes that society tries to impose on her. Through Anya's journey, readers embark on a thought-provoking exploration of the limitations and absurdities of gender norms.

Anya's bold spirit resonates with a diverse cast of characters who embrace their own unique qualities. Together, they form an unbreakable bond that defies the narrow confines of "normalcy." As they navigate the complexities of adolescence, they discover the true meaning of friendship, loyalty, and self-worth.

The Power of Authenticity

At the heart of "Rebels Don't Fall for Tomboys Invisible Girls Club" lies a profound message about the transformative power of authenticity. The novel challenges readers to question their own beliefs and biases, encouraging them to embrace their true selves without fear of judgment.

Through Anya's compelling journey, the author deftly illustrates that conformity is a suffocating illusion. By shedding the masks that society tries to force upon them, girls can unlock their true potential and live lives filled with purpose and fulfillment.

Inspiring a New Generation of Rebels

"Rebels Don't Fall for Tomboys Invisible Girls Club" is not merely a captivating tale; it is a powerful catalyst for change. The novel empowers young readers to break free from societal expectations and to embrace their authentic selves without hesitation.

With its thought-provoking themes and relatable characters, "Rebels Don't Fall for Tomboys Invisible Girls Club" has the potential to inspire a generation of girls who are confident, courageous, and determined to carve their own paths in the world.

In a world that often tries to silence and diminish the voices of girls, "Rebels Don't Fall for Tomboys Invisible Girls Club" stands as a resounding affirmation of their power and resilience. This extraordinary novel is a must-read for any girl who yearns to embrace her unique identity and to live a life that is true to herself.

As the final page turns, readers are left with an enduring message that reverberates through their hearts: true belonging comes from within, and the most fulfilling lives are built on the foundation of authenticity.
